I am sorry to hear about those of you that held on. We began worrying when the site work was never started and we get the runaround from THP. We had heard that there were financial issues with THP and that they were unable to pay their contractors. We were lucky to know people with truthful information. THP lied to their buyers. They continued to tell us that their company was stable and denied financial troubles--we have all of the emails. In November I went to the corporate office and they reported that they were giving Wynstone buyers the option to locate to a new community. They told us they would not likely refund us bc the project was expected to begin. Whatever. I met with the manager and we were given the option to look at homes in Coddington. We had our heart set on the Brandon model, however we knew THP was not going to last and they had our savings basically. We looked at three homes and chose one within a day. We settled six weeks ago which we are thankful for, however now we were about the mechanics liens. I am sorry to those of you--we saved all of our correspondence including the BS they fed to us. They knew back in the fall that they were in severe financial trouble yet they continued to take deposits, sell homes, etc. How much will legal expenses cost everyone now? Wynstone was not going to happen--they needed four banks to sign on and fund it. THP knew this yet they misled people with deposits down. They did not seek out the Wynstone buyers--if you were persistent and demanding then you were offered to go to Northgate or Coddington. Those of you who were not basically stalking them, they acted like you did not exist. The owners are crooks and I hope they will get jail time over this.
